Stellantis launches new reorganization

TURIN (ITALPRESS) – Stellantis today taking steps to streamline its organization. Among the appointments are those of Bob Broderdorf as head of the Jeep brand, Alain Favey becoming the new head of the Peugeot brand, Xavier Peugeot as head of the DS Automobiles brand, and Anne Abboud as head of the Stellantis Pro One commercial vehicle unit. “In line with the changes decided in December, today’s announcements will further simplify our organization and increase our agility and rigor of execution locally,” comments Stellantis Chairman John Elkann, “We look forward to driving growth by providing our customers with an even broader choice of extraordinary combustion, hybrid and electric vehicles. Among other decisions, from now on regions will have greater local decision-making and executive capabilities for product planning and development, industrial and commercial activities, while maintaining coordination with global functions.
Software activities are now integrated into a product development and technology organization led by Ned Curic in order to streamline the process of bringing innovative products and services to market for all brands and in all markets where the company has a presence. In addition to his current role as COO of Americas Regions, Antonio Filosa also assumes global leadership of the Quality entity. The Corporate Affairs and Communications entities are merged under the leadership of Clara Ingen-Housz. Finally, a new Marketing Office is created, headed by Olivier François, to group the marketing of brands and support them through advertising, global events, and sponsorships. As announced in early December 2024, the process of appointing a new Chief Executive Officer is ongoing, is managed by a Special Committee of the Board of Directors, and will be completed by the first half of 2025.
